Ok I see these have different hashes, so the contents of the seemingly duplicate clips are different.  See my reply above about this, and go into the blobs with the blob interrogator and let us see which formats are different...

I have noticed that MS excel this can happen also -- its happening maybe because these MS Office apps are doing something strange.. perhaps copying to the clipboard in two separate events in quick succession, for some reason I don't understand.  Or perhaps CHS is trying to read the clipboard before the app finishes with it..

Here's something that may fix it.  I've added a new option to increase the delay between the triggering of a clipboard event and CHS acting on that trigger, so that 2 quick success triggers will only result in the final capture:


As I said earlier, the other fix which will be available in a future version of CHS will be if the clips are duplicates except for a one or two irrelevant data formats, to mark those formats as IGNORE or IGNORE-FOR-PURPOSES-OF-CALCULATING-UNIQUE-HASH.

Other possible solutions would be: Having a list of applications that CHS should increase delay-before-capture behavior, or some kind of smart process to overwrite the previous clip when the subsequent one happens in super fast succession.
